Assists the Director in managing the operations of the St. Mary’s County Department of Emergency Services. Manages, coordinates, and assesses the work of assigned staff under the general direction of the Director to ensure operations comply with policies and procedures. Recommends policy changes and coordinates improvements that enhance response for allied agencies. Represents the department and communicates goals and objectives with staff and allied agencies;

oversees the operations, activities, and programs within assigned divisions; performs other duties as assigned.

The hiring salary for this position is $109,116 - $143,208 annually; full salary range for this position is $109,116 - $187,928 annually.

  • Assists the Director with planning, directing, organizing, and coordinating programs related to the operations of the Department. Provides oversight of various divisions of the department as directed by the Director and may include Emergency Management, Emergency Medical Services, Animal Services Division, 911 Communications, Radio Repair, Administrative and Fiscal Divisions.
  • In coordination with the Director and the Department of Human Resources, provides oversight of the Personnel/Human Resource needs of the Department of Emergency Services.
  • Recommends, plans, and implements system operational improvements and enhancements for the Department of Emergency Services.
  • Reviews operations of assigned divisions and may establish and monitor metrics that evaluate performance; recommends appropriate actions to correct performance deficiencies and may assist with adjusting operations to meet or exceed standards.
  • Ensures annual proficiency training is performed in accordance with approved training plans. Reviews training plans to outline requisite training relevant to each division. Makes recommendations for changes based on organizational needs. .
  • Supervises assigned staff; counsel’s employees and recommends disciplinary actions; enforces Department and County policies and procedures.
  • Coordinates programs and activities with allied agencies; reports problems promptly to the Director and/or appropriate allied agencies and takes appropriate corrective action to restore normal operations.
  • Assists with developing and maintaining department plans to effectively respond to unexpected situations, operational changes, and emergency situations; communicates necessary procedural changes (immediate and long-term) to all parties involved to ensure an appropriate departmental response.
  • Assists with analyzing technical performance reports and preparing management reports; may collect, analyze, and evaluate data that measures performance and identifies needed improvements.
  • Assists the Director with ensuring that the Department is operating in compliance with and acts as a liaison between Federal, State, and local governmental agencies whose policies, laws, regulations, and directives impact County operations.
  • Assists the Director with providing budget recommendations on departmental programs, human resources, technological enhancements, and County policies and procedures.
  • Increases professional knowledge through attendance of training, workshops, and conferences; participates in professional associations and activities.
  • Provides oversight, guidance and mentorship of all Emergency Services Divisions supervisors.
  • Performs all other duties as assigned.
